A paradise among light and fabrics

Odette Álvarez presented her "Paraíso" Spring 2026 collection at Mercedes-Benz Fashion Week Madrid. The collection celebrates the fashion brand's fifteen-year fashion journey with a tribute to the women who have accompanied the fashion designer along the way, viewing fashion as an intimate language, a way of inhabiting the world with authenticity and freedom. The collection is an emotional journey that traverses between quotidian and exotic, handcrafts and urban, lightness and opulence.

The inspiration is based on three creative universes: the Oriental influence, a constant in the designer's DNA; Art Nouveau's organic ornamentation, and the formal purity of ancient Greece. In this interplay of references, Odette Álvarez proposes a contemporary, handcrafted luxury that finds its strength in contrast, combining tradition and modernity with aesthetic sensitivity.

The silhouettes embrace the body, revealing it through second-skin fabrics, along with linen and poplin that bring a refreshing summer feel. The richness of the collection is enhanced with embellishments such as beading, embroidery, metal appliqués, and beadwork. The color palette oscillates between the luminosity of gold and silver and the vibrancy of pastels—pink, green, turquoise—in balance with earthy tones, such as ivory and chocolate brown. The fashion show's atmosphere evokes an eternal summer: an impromptu setting, lights illuminating the space, and radiant women inhabiting their own paradise.

The collection reaffirms Odette Álvarez's signature style as a territory where beauty unfolds unexpectedly, woven with memory, desire, and the present.
